Full Job Description
The Client Executive will serve as a top-level manager in a successful, growing firm. They will interact regularly with senior representatives of current and prospective clients. The Client Executive will oversee all client relations for a particular client or multiple clients, including project team performance and overall client satisfaction. The Client Executive will have extremely strong inter-personal skills with an aggressive, yet personable, demeanor.



 

Your Impact:

Strategic: The Client Executive will be a key contributor to further defining and guiding the strategic plan. PBK’s corporate resources and management team will be made available to assist the Client Executive in meeting these goals.

Operational: The Client Executive will ultimately be responsible for the delivery of services, the development of culture and the execution of processes within the offices. They will oversee client relations, including project team performance and overall client satisfaction.

Marketing/Business Development: The ability to establish and develop relationships with potential clients is essential. They will work closely with the firm’s Marketing & Business Development departments to develop new opportunities and build relationships.

Management/Leadership: The Client Executive will promote a support structure to further develop the abilities of the staff. They will also be responsible for staffing projections and overseeing the recruitment of new staff.

Here's What You'll Need:

  • Must be a Registered Architect in the State.
  • Must have a minimum of 15 years of experience in the architectural profession with no less than 10 years of experience managing project teams and processes.
  • Must have prior K12 and/or Higher Education experience to be considered.
